Key Fields within the Appeal Form Template

To review an appeal fairly, administrators need complete context from day one. This template collects all necessary parameters in a clear, sequential flow:

  • Contact Information: Gathers the appellant’s full name, email address, and phone number to ensure reliable follow-up.
  • Appeal Classification: Uses a multiple-choice question to define the nature of the appeal, such as an academic grade, an insurance claim denial, or a workplace disciplinary action.
  • Case Context and Resolution Goal: Includes dedicated open-ended text areas where the applicant can describe the situation leading to the appeal and specify the exact outcome they are hoping to achieve.
  • Evidence Uploads: Features a file upload field for supporting documents, such as medical notes, academic transcripts, or email correspondence, that back up the appellant’s claims.

Improving Processing Times and Organization

One of the most common bottlenecks in appeal management is the submission of incomplete forms. Administrators often have to exchange multiple emails to track down supporting evidence or ask for clarification. By utilizing a guided digital layout, you can make vital fields mandatory—such as the explanation of the situation and the supporting document upload. This ensures that when the review committee meets, they have a complete package to evaluate immediately.

Integrating Appeals into Case Workflows

Handling appeals via standard email inboxes can lead to lost files and missed deadlines. Transitioning to a digital form allows you to connect submissions to your preferred case management tool, shared spreadsheet, or administrative dashboard. You can set up automated acknowledgement emails to let the appellant know their case has been successfully received and outline what the next steps and expected timelines look like, fostering trust throughout the process.

What is an appeal form?

An appeal form is a structured document used by individuals to formally request a review or reconsideration of a decision made by an authority, such as an insurance carrier, academic institution, or employer.

How does a digital appeal form speed up review times?

It ensures that all necessary information—such as contact details, the grounds for appeal, desired outcomes, and supporting evidence—is collected in a complete package on the first attempt, preventing back-and-forth communication.

What kinds of supporting files can be uploaded?

Appellants can upload a variety of files including PDFs, photos, word documents, and spreadsheets. This is ideal for medical certificates, academic transcripts, event logs, or relevant email exchanges.

How should organizations handle incomplete appeal submissions?

To prevent incomplete submissions, configure your digital form with validation rules and set essential fields, such as the detailed description and evidence upload, as required before submission is allowed.
